The Albemarle Patriots will venture away from home to challenge the Charlottesville Black Knights at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. Albemarle will be strutting in after a win while Charlottesville will be coming in after a defeat.
Charlottesville will be up against a hot Albemarle team: the squad just extended their winning streak to three. Albemarle strolled past Monticello with points to spare on Friday, taking the game 63-45. Given the Patriots' advantage in MaxPreps' Virginia basketball rankings (they are ranked 168th, while the Mustangs are ranked 368th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Meanwhile, Charlottesville unfortunately witnessed the end of their nine-game winning streak on Saturday. They fell just short of Spotswood by a score of 53-50.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est loss the Black Knights have suffered since February 27, 2024.
Charlottesville's defeat dropped their record down to 9-2. As for Albemarle, their victory bumped their record up to 6-7.
Albemarle was taken down by Charlottesville 66-32 in their previous meeting back in February of 2024. Can Albemarle av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
